My dermatologist did some bloods before deciding whether and what dose to put me on finasteride.
My DHT came back 0.83 with a laboratory normal range of 1.13 - 4.13.
He said this means DHT is unlikely to be a major factor in causing my hair loss and therefore limits the chances of finasteride working. I have particularly severe ball ache on a previous attempt with finasteride. He is going to write to Merck to see if he can get an explanation for the ache but he said it might be because my DHT is already on the low side such that i get the severe ache.
This dermatologist is well known in London and specialises in hair loss. He also gives some of his patients a topical lotion that consists off 6% minoxidil, 0.2% melatonin, and 0.2% finastride and apparently gets decent results with that in his patient population.
He wants me to tread very carefully due to low DHT.
